cargo-partner launched the Vienna Consolidation service for shipments from Japan to CEE.

Logistics company cargo-partner, part of Nippon Express Holdings, has launched a new sea service Vienna Consolidation, developed in cooperation with Nippon Express. It offers efficient solutions for LCL transportation from Japan to 26 cities in Central and Eastern Europe, including Vienna, Bratislava, Prague, Budapest, Warsaw, Poznan and other major logistics hubs in the region.

Cargo from key Japanese ports (Yokohama, Nagoya, Kobe, Hakata, Moji) is delivered by road to Tokyo, where it is consolidated, then sent by sea to Hamburg and further to Vienna for distribution to the regions. Thanks to the tight integration of cargo-partner and NX Group networks, full control over the logistics chain and optimization of delivery times are ensured.

The Vienna Consolidation service is focused on the growing demand for reliable and affordable LCL transportation between Japan and CEE. It offers flexible consolidation terms, high logistics transparency and accelerated delivery times, making it an attractive solution for companies developing their supply chains between Asia and Europe.
